Transaction ba31c589277c57ae438a587361b7d967116a15a0a054da3a40b33b83e9143292
1 Input
1 Output
-
ba31c589277c57ae438a587361b7d967116a15a0a054da3a40b33b83e9143292:0
- value
- 642515420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24001414b55f215d29385c62e90e3d646948a332 OP_EQUAL
- address
- 34yNLu9GA2LDfwtjMowGKQnKo6HedFbfXm